Устанавливаем батарейку для контроллера Supermicro AOC-S3108L-H8iR-16DD. Модуль покупается дополнительно:
- CacheVault Module, BTR-TFM8G-LSICVM02, Supercap/TFM Unit for cached data protection - operating temperature (Ambient) from 10°C - 55°C.
Это сама батарейка с платой расширений для контроллера, проводом и винтами. - CacheVault Installation Kit, MCP-240-00127-0N, Supermicro kit - Uses drive slot.
Это комплект крепления батарейки в дисковый слот. Однако, эта штука ещё не пришла, просто покажу как установить батарейку в дисковый слот без этого комплекта. Возможно, когда комплект доставят, я дополню статью. - CacheVault Installation Kit, BKT-BBU-BRACKET-05, Broadcom kit - Uses PCI slot.
Это комплект крепления батарейки в PCI слот. Не заказывал и в данной статье рассматриваться не будет.
Ссылки
Supermicro — настраиваем RAID 5 и RAID 10 на контроллере AOC-S3108L-H8iR-16DD
RAID контроллер Supermicro AOC-S3108L-H8iR-16DD
CacheVault CVPM02 для контроллера MegaRAID SAS 9380-8i8e
Упаковка и комплектация
Упаковано в коробку с поролоном. Никаких инструкций нет.
Весь набор в пакетике.
Я заказывал два комплекта, видимо, их просто разобрали и сунули в одну коробку, а инструкции потеряли. Но они нам не понадобятся.
Чтобы не запутаться сразу отложу в сторонку второй комплект.
В один комплект входят:
- Батарейка с металлическим креплением.
- Плата расширений для RAID контроллера.
- Пакет с тремя винтами для металлического крепления батарейки.
- Пакет с четырьмя винтами и двумя ножками для крепления платы расширений к контроллеру.
- Пакет с двумя винтами.
- Длинный кабель для подключения батарейки.
Батарейка упакована в антистатический пакет.
Батарейка без упаковки.
На батарейке металлическое крепление.
Плата расширения для RAID контроллера упакована в антистатический пакет.
Плата расширения без упаковки. На этой стороне имеется разъём для крепления платы к контроллеру.
На другой стороне имеется разъём для подключения кабеля от батарейки.
Пакет с тремя винтами для металлического крепления батарейки. Нам он сегодня не понадобится.
Пакет с четырьмя винтами и двумя ножками для крепления платы расширений к контроллеру.
Пакет с двумя винтами. Мне не понадобился.
Длинный кабель для подключения батарейки.
Сборка
Снимаем RAID контроллер.
Привинчиваем к RAID контроллеру две ножки.
Устанавливаем на RAID контроллер плату расширения.
Крепим плату расширений к ножкам двумя винтами.
Вот что получилось.
Мне удобнее потом подсоединить кабель к плате расширения.
Устанавливаем RAID контроллер обратно в сервер.
Я планировал установить батарейку в дисковый слот, однако, крепление не пришло. Просто кладу батарейку в пустые салазки.
Устанавливаем салазки так, чтобы провод от батарейки торчал внутрь сервера.
Укладываем длинный кабель и подсоединяем к батарейке.
Итог.
Загрузка
У меня уже были сконфигурированы виртуальные диски.
Supermicro — настраиваем RAID 5 и RAID 10 на контроллере AOC-S3108L-H8iR-16DD
Собираем сервер и включаем.
При загрузке нам пишут:
Ваши виртуальные диски сконфигурированы в режиме write-back кеширования, но временно работают в режиме write-through. Причиной является либо отсутствие батарейки, или батарейка заряжается, не определяется, сломана. Если вы используете батарейку, дайте ей зарядиться 24 часа перед тем, как начинать процесс замены. Вы можете определить состояние батарейки в соответствующей утилите, операционной системе или во время загрузки.
Итак, состояние батарейки непонятно, при загрузке ничего конкретно не говорится, в ОС мы не полезем. Посмотрим состояние в утилите RAID контроллера.
Нажимаем Ctrl+R и попадаем в утилиту Avago 3108 MegaRAID Configuration Utility.
Заходим в Properties. Уже хорошо, видно, что статус контроллера и батарейки — Optimal.
Заходим в управление контроллером, Manage Battery.
Тип батарейки CVPM02, состояние — Optimal, температура нормальная — 25°C. Период обучения 27 дней, следующий цикл отсутствует. Тоже пока ничего плохого.
Заходим в свойства любого виртуального диска.
И вот теперь становится всё понятно. Массив настроен на Write Back, однако работает как Write Through, потому что BBU (Battery Backup Unit) в состоянии re-learn.
Это означает, что RAID контроллер зарядит батарейку, потом проверит, как долго она держит заряд. Если всё в порядке, то виртуальные диски автоматически перейдут в режим Write Back. Если батарейка не держит заряд, то RAID контроллер потребует её заменить. Такая процедура будет происходить каждые 27 дней. К сожалению, во время проверки есть риск потери данных при внезапном отключении питания. Увы.
P.S. после заряда батарейки
Батарейка у меня зарядилась через два часа. При загрузке нет предупреждений:
Battery Status: Optimal.
В свойствах батарейки теперь указан Next Learn Cycle Time.
В свойствах массива статус кеша — Write Back, что нам и требовалось.